MRC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2015 in Review

168 of the 3,754 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in MRC Global (MRC) for Q1 2015, worth a combined $1.27B — down 12% from $1.43B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 44 funds closed out of MRC and 30 opened new positions — a net loss of 14 holders — while 58 trimmed existing stakes and 61 added.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$101M. The largest seller was Boston Partners, cutting an estimated $33.6M.
